Happy FM/Lakeside Estate honour long-standing commitment to Mercy Social Centre with generous donation

Share on FacebookShare on TwitterShare on Whatsapp

Leading radio station in Ghana, Happy 98.9 FM and prominent real estate developer, Lakeside Estate have once again upheld their annual tradition of supporting the Mercy Social Centre with a significant donation of essential items.

This contribution is a key component of both organizations’ Corporate Social Responsibility (CSR) initiatives. Notably, Happy FM and Lakeside Estate jointly organize the annual Family Fun Run and Walk, also known as the ‘Charity Run,’ held every March 6th. This event not only promotes family engagement and healthy living but also serves as a crucial fundraising platform for the Mercy Social Centre.

A dedicated 25 percent of all revenue generated from participant registration fees during the Family Fun Run and Walk is allocated to the Mercy Social Centre. These funds are vital in supporting the provision of quality care and living conditions for the children residing at the home.

For over fifteen years, Happy FM and Lakeside Estate have consistently demonstrated their unwavering commitment and passion for the Mercy Social Centre through this annual support.

The donated items, valued in tens of thousands of cedis, included a substantial quantity of provisions, toiletries, biscuits, drinks, stationery, running shirts and shorts, riding shirts and socks, and running shoes.

Speaking at the presentation ceremony, Salah Kweku Kalmoni, Executive Director of Run Ghana, expressed his satisfaction in the continued partnership between the two brands and the Mercy Social Centre. “We made a commitment to annually visit and donate to the Mercy Social Centre, and we are pleased to be here once again this year. Our dedication to this worthy cause is something we deeply value and will consistently uphold. We are also delighted to announce that following the recent run, several of our sponsors generously augmented the funds specifically designated for the Mercy Social Centre.”

Mr. Kwabena Ampong, Programmes Manager of Happy FM, elaborated on the source of the donation. “The items presented today represent a portion of the proceeds raised during the 15th annual Happy FM and Lakeside Marina Park Family Fun Run, which took place on Ghana’s Independence Day. We extend our sincere gratitude to all the participants, sponsors, and supporters of this year’s Family Fun Run, without whom this contribution to the Mercy Social Centre would not be possible.”

Receiving the donation on behalf of the Mercy Social Centre, Ali Abdul Salam Ali, Director of the Centre, conveyed his profound appreciation to Happy FM and Lakeside Estate for their enduring support of the home and its residents.

“We are deeply humbled by this consistent act of kindness and encourage other organizations to emulate this exemplary gesture by also donating to the Mercy Social Centre,” Mr. Ali stated, urging other entities to follow the philanthropic lead of Happy FM and Lakeside Estate.
